相关文章
Java面试题:MVCC
MVCC
保证事务的隔离性
排它锁:
一个事务获取了数据行的排他锁,其他事务就不能再获取该行的其他锁
MVCC:
多版本并发控制
维护一个数据的多个版本,使读写不存在冲突
具体实现依靠
隐藏字段
mysql中隐藏了三个隐藏字段
db_trx_id:最近修改事务
db_roll_ptr:指向上一个…
建站知识
2024/11/23 18:09:50
MYSQl命令总结:1.数据类型、数据库、表、约束
数据库命令
查看数据库
show databases;
查看数据库编码
select schema_name,default_character_set_name from information_schema.schemata where schema_name moonwood_wtl;
创建数据库
create database test default character set utf8;
删除数据库
drop databas…
建站知识
2024/11/23 18:09:56
LiteOS增加执行自定义源码
开发过程注意事项: 源码工程路径不能太长 源码工程路径不能有中文 一定要关闭360等杀毒软件,否则编译的打包阶段会出错
增加自定义源码的步骤: 1.创建源码目录 2. 创建源文件
新建myhello目录后,再此目录下再新建源文件myhello_demo.c 3. 编…
建站知识
2024/11/23 18:09:52
springboot+vue项目实战2024第四集修改文章信息
1.添加文章信息 PostMappingpublic Result add(RequestBody Validated Article article){articleService.add(article);return Result.success();}void add(Article article);
Override
public void add(Article article) {article.setCreateTime(LocalDateTime.now());article…
建站知识
2024/11/23 18:09:54
splice方法的使用#Vue3
splice方法的使用
splice(index,len,item)是vue中对数组进行操作的方法之一,可以用来删除,更新,和增加数组内容 参数: index:数组下标 len:为1或0 item:更新或增加的内容 使用方法: 删除,当参数形式为spli…
建站知识
2024/11/23 19:06:53
httprunner3-增加Setp执行时跳过用例(extract()提取变量不等于预期结果时)
背景:由于httprunner3只能用pytest的skip方法跳过所执行的用例,不能针对执行用例中动态去跳过用例,所以稍微对httprunner3加个跳过的小功能(查过httprunner2 是有skip关键字的,不知道为啥3就去掉了)
实际使…
建站知识
2024/11/23 19:06:51
构建LangChain应用程序的示例代码:62、如何使用Oracle AI向量搜索和Langchain构建端到端的RAG(检索增强生成)pipeline
Oracle AI 向量搜索与文档处理
Oracle AI向量搜索专为人工智能(AI)工作负载设计,允许您基于语义而非关键词来查询数据。 Oracle AI向量搜索的最大优势之一是可以在单一系统中结合对非结构化数据的语义搜索和对业务数据的关系搜索。 这不仅功能强大,而且…
建站知识
2024/11/23 5:47:06
医疗器械FDA |FDA网络安全测试具体内容
医疗器械FDA网络安全测试的具体内容涵盖了多个方面,以确保医疗器械在网络环境中的安全性和合规性。以下是根据权威来源归纳的FDA网络安全测试的具体内容:
一、技术文件审查
网络安全计划:制造商需要提交网络安全计划,详细描述产…
建站知识
2024/11/23 19:06:55